Revealing Hidden Updates in Windows
Access Windows Updates by typing “update” in the search field from the Start menu and selecting “Windows Update”.
- On the Windows Update screen, select “Restore hidden updates” from the links on the left.
- The list shown will include all updates you’ve chosen to hide. While you cannot sort this list by date, generally, the number of hidden updates is manageable.
- Select the updates you wish to unhide by ticking their respective checkboxes. Alternatively, choose all updates by selecting the checkbox at the top of the list.
- After making your selections, click “Restore”. You may need to provide administrator credentials or approval to proceed.

Q: How can I prevent a problematic update from reinstalling on my Windows machine?
A: Utilize the Show/Hide Updates tool provided by Microsoft to temporarily prevent the unwanted update from reinstalling automatically.
